How Our Contaminated Water Removal Process Works

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ition. We understand the importance of acting fast and getting it right the first time. Our process includes:

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

We send a certified technician to ass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further contamination. Our team uses heavy-duty barriers and negative air machines to isolate the area and prevent moisture from spreading. This step typically takes 30 minutes to 1 hour to complete.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use industrial-grade pumps to extract standing water from your property. Our team works efficiently to remove as much water as possible, often completing this step within 1-2 hours. We also use air movers to circulate air and speed up the drying process.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We use state-of-the-art drying systems to remove moisture from your property. Our team works to dry the affected area within 3-5 days depending on the severity of the damage. We also use dehumidifiers to maintain a healthy humidity level and prevent mold growth.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

We use eco-friendly cleaning agents to sanitize and disinfect the affected area. Our team works to remove any remaining moisture and prevent future mold growth. This step typically takes 1-2 hours to complete.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ification

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ition. We provide a certification of completion and a 5-year warranty on our work. This step typically takes 30 minutes to 1 hour to complete.

Contaminated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No You can likely handle a small spill with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els.
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es A large spill need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Water damage in a crawl space or attic No Yes These areas need specialized equipment and safety precautions to access and remediate.
Musty odors or mold growth No Yes Mold and mildew need specialized cleaning and remediation techniques to ensure your health and safety.
Water damage in a sensitive or historic area No Yes These areas need specialized techniques and equipment to preserve the integrity and historical value of the area.
Water damage in a large commercial space No Yes Commercial spaces need specialized equipment and expertise to handle large-scale water damage and reduce downtime.

With Contaminated Water Removal, it’s essential to call a professional if you’re unsure about how to handle the situation. Contaminated Water Removal Cost In Shelton, WA

The cost of Contaminated Water Removal in Shelton, WA,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ices are estimates, not guarantees, and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Get a free estimate today and let our team help you understand the costs involved.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Water Extraction and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ment requirements
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and equipment requirements
Final Inspection and Certification $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and equipment requirements
Emergency Service (24/7) $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
